TDR00369 Pressure Transducer
Pressure transducers measure pressure and convert that pressure into a continuous voltage output (V). The DC voltage output is typically amplified into industry-standard outputs such as 0-5V or 0-10V. Pressure transducers can also provide unamplified millivolt outputs (mV) which offer higher frequency response and lower power consumption but are also more susceptible to electrical noise.

SEN02128 Liquid Level Sensor
Liquid level sensors are used to monitor and regulate levels of a particular free-flowing substance within a contained space. These substances are usually liquid, however liquid level sensors can also be used to monitor solids, such as powders. There are many different types of liquid level sensors, and they have several uses, both industrial and in the household for example.
